Brazil secures podium places at the 2019 World Beach Games. The Brazilians claimed two podium places, maintaining their dominance since 2006 in all the events in which they competed.
The men’s team won their fourth championship with the gold medal, whilst the women’s team secured a place on the podium with the bronze medal.
Is men’s team beat Oman and the United States 2-0, whilst the women also defeated Argentina and the United States 2-0.
In the second round, the women’s team secured two further victories, this time against Tunisia and Hungary; and the men suffered their only defeat against Denmark 2-0 but managed to bounce back against Australia, winning 2-0.
The final round of the group stage, the women’s team had already qualified for the quarter-finals, beating Denmark and finishing top of the group. The men beat Sweden 2-0 and also secured a place in the quarter-finals.
Brazil in the World Beach Games finals
The teams progressed to the knockout stage, aiming to repeat the podium finishes they achieved in 2017 in Poland, playing three matches each, leading up to the gold medal match for the men’s team and the bronze medal match for the women’s team.
In the quarter-finals, both teams won: Brazil 2–1 Croatia (men) and Brazil 2–0 Poland (women).
The men’s team went on to secure two further victories, beating Qatar 2–1 in the semi-finals and Spain in the final.
Meanwhile, the women’s team suffered their only defeat in the semi-finals, losing 2-1 to Denmark, and went on to play the third-place play-off, beating Vietnam 2-0 to claim the bronze medal.
Women’s team:
Goalkeeper: Ingrid Frazão (APCEF);
Defenders: Carolina Braz (HFT / América), Jessica Barros (Clube Português / 7HB) and Gabriela Messias (360 Grados nas Areias);
Specialists: Camila Souza (APCEF) and Juliana Oliveira (Clube Português / 7HB);
Wingers: Beatriz Cruz (CEPREA / Vasco), Cinthya Pires (APCEF) and Patrícia Scheppa (360 Grados nas Areias);
Centre: Renata Santiago (Rio Hand Beach).
Coaching staff: Márcio Magliano (head coach), Vinícius Oliveira (assistant coach) and Sheila Pinheiro (physiotherapist).
Men’s squad:
Goalkeeper: Cristiano Rosa (AHPA / SESPOR / Paranaguá);
Defenders: Diogo Vieira (Rio Hand Beach), Marcelo Machado (Niterói Rugby) and Thiago Barcellos (Palletways V Azuqueca / ESP);
Fly-half: Bruno Oliveira (AHPA / SESPOR / Paranaguá);
Wingers: João Paulo Sousa (AHPA / SESPOR / Paranaguá), Matheus Medeiros (MHC), Nailson Amaral (ABC / Carcará) and Wellington Esteves (AHPA / SESPOR / Paranaguá);
Centre: Gil Pires (AHPA / SESPOR / Paranaguá).
Technical Committee: Antônio Guerra Peixe (Head Coach), Aldivan Andrade (Assistant Coach) and Carlos Roque Silva (Supervisor).
